History
Date | Chamber | Action |
---|---|---|
2024-03-05 | Senate | Signed by the Governor on March 05, 2024 S.J. 482 |
2024-02-27 | Senate | Delivered to the Governor on February 27, 2024 S.J. 422 |
2024-02-26 | House | Signed by the Speaker H.J. 407 |
2024-02-23 | Senate | Signed by the President S.J. 405 |
2024-02-22 | House | House of Representatives Do Pass, Passed, YEAS 49, NAYS 20. H.J. 381 |
2024-02-21 | House | Judiciary Do Pass, Passed, YEAS 9, NAYS 3. |
2024-02-21 | House | Scheduled for hearing |
2024-02-02 | House | First read in House and referred to House Judiciary H.J. 238 |
2024-02-01 | Senate | Senate Do Pass, Passed, YEAS 29, NAYS 2. S.J. 239 |
2024-01-31 | Senate | Remove from Consent Calendar S.J. 221 |
2024-01-30 | Senate | Certified uncontested, placed on consent |
2024-01-30 | Senate | Judiciary Do Pass, Passed, YEAS 7, NAYS 0. |
2024-01-30 | Senate | Scheduled for hearing |
2024-01-16 | Senate | First read in Senate and referred to Senate Judiciary S.J. 86 |
